The Covid19 pandemic had a major impact on the weakening of Indonesia's economic sector, including Small, Micro and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s). The MSME sector is one of the sectors that makes a major contribution to the national economy so it needs to rise during the current Covid19 pandemic. Jambewangi Village is a village located in Sempu District, Banyuwangi Regency, East Java Province. The area of Jambewangi Village is 1,422 Ha / m2 divided into six hamlets including Krajan Hamlet, Panjen Hamlet, Parastembok Hamlet, Sumberjo Hamlet, Tlogosari Hamlet, and Sidomulyo Hamlet. In Jambewangi Village, it has an interesting landscape, such as a homogeneous forest in the form of pines, the confluence of tributaries with branches, a large expanse of rice fields, as well as fields and plantations. The area of Jambewangi Village is at an altitude of 340-800 masl so it has cool air and is good for growing various kinds of fruits and vegetables.

Management Drug management consists of Planning, Procurement, Receiving, Storage, Distribution, Destruction, Control. During the Covid 19 pandemic, demand for medicines in the world increased to USD 4.5 billion, for this reason it is necessary to carry out good medicine management. This research uses a qualitative research method with a case study approach. The informants in this research were the Head of the Community Health Center, Head of the Medicine Warehouse, Medicine Warehouse Installation Staff, and Health Installation Staff at Simpang Jaya Health Center, Tadu Raya District, Nagan Raya Regency and from triangulated data. This research was conducted from February to October 2021, data collection was carried out by means of in-depth interviews and questionnaires. Data analysis by identifying problems using a fishbone diagram to obtain cause and effect relationships. The results of this research show that expert professions in drug management are very necessary, in order to achieve drug management in accordance with the Minister of Health's Regulation, the lack of cupboards is also an obstacle in drug management, the lack of facilities and infrastructure in the Puskesmas includes electronic devices such as computers so that the recording and reporting of drugs is still manually. It is recommended that the implementation of drug management based on the Minister of Health's Regulation concerning Standard Technical Instructions for Public Health Center Pharmaceutical Services in 2019 be maintained.

Social Services include activities and interactions that occur between social workers or caregivers and the elderly while they are in the orphanage. This research aims to determine the main problems in service, the form of service implemented as well as supporting and inhibiting factors. This research uses a library study method by utilizing literature materials in the form of books, journals and articles that are in line with the title or theme of the research. The results of the research show that the main problem in social services for the elderly is that it is difficult to manage the activities provided by social workers. The form of social services for the elderly after the Covid-19 pandemic implemented by Tresna Werdha nursing house Budi Mulia 3 includes physical changes and social changes for the elderly and provides four types of social services, namely food services, religious services, entertainment services and recreation services. In Religious Services, social workers use religious approaches such as reciting the newspaper, reading the newspaper, reading Surah Yasin.

Coronavirus Disease 2019 (COVID-19) is an infectious disease caused by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ome Co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2). SARS-CoV-2 is a new type of coronavirus that has never been previously identified in humans. Corona virus or what is known as Covid-19 is a new case of pneumonia that was first reported in Wuhan, Hubei Province. Within a month, this disease had spread to various other provinces in China, Thailand, Japan and South Korea. Implementing clean and healthy living behavior (PHBS) during the Covid19 pandemic can break the chain of virus spread. The aim of this literature review is to see how the Indonesian people implemented clean and healthy living behavior programs during the Covid-19 pandemic. The methodology used to write this article is based on a literature review approach. The journal collection process is based on criteria determined in literature research. Participation criteria are journals published in the last 5 years and indexed in Google Scholar. The results of this article explain the clean and healthy living behavior of the community during the Covid-19 period. Based on the results of this research, it can be concluded that there has been a change in clean and healthy living behavior in Indonesian society during the Covid- 19 period.

The pandemic has an impact on almost all sectors of life. The emerging of the covid virus made everyone have to adapt to the new world rules. The health protocol is one way to control the COVID-19 disease. In other ways such as vaccination. In case no need a lot of cost, health protocols are also effective in reducing the number of cases of COVID-19. The implementation of the health protocol in its implementation is accompanied by sanctions to make the community more obedient. However, the unclear rules, and the frequent changes in these rules make many people who violate health protocols and get sanctions for it. Not to mention the uneven socialization from the government that makes people less disciplined towards health protocols.

Covid-19 pandemic that hit almost all countries and no exception beloved our country Indonesia, has resulted in destruction and the collapse of the community’s economy. At the same time there is information about the covid-19 virus that still needs to be questioned about the validity of the source. With the development of technology in today’s era, it is easier for us to filter information that has valid sources so that there are no misunderstandings about the information obtained. So on this basis, this study aims to develop a chatbot model regarding Covid-19 in a relevant and fast manner according to the questions and statements entered. Chatbot itself is an Artificial Intelligence-based program or we can call it a digital assistant, which can simulate user conversations or chats like humans through an application either based on Android or the web. By using chatbot technology, users can get valid and relevant answers whose sources are clear so as not to cause anxiety and also make it easier for users to get information about the Covid-19 virus.   Keywords: Covid-19; Technology; Chatbot; Artifical Intelligence

Background: Breast milk is a liquid generated by the mother's breast glands in the form of natural food or the most nutrient-rich and high-energy milk created during pregnancy, which is always accessible and free of contaminants (Intan & Fitria, 2020). Breast milk is a diet that includes all of the essential nutrients for the growth and development of infants (Liliek Fauziah, 2020). Postpartum refers to the period of time between the birth of the baby and the expulsion of the placenta from the uterus and the next six weeks or approximately 40 days, which are accompanied by the recovery of organs related to the womb, which undergo changes such as injuries and others related to childbirth. Research Aim: The research aims to examine the relationship between postpartum mother anxiety and the ease of nursing during the Covid-19 epidemic. Research Design: The research employs the method of analytical observation with a cross-sectional design. The sample consists of 59 postpartum mothers who gave birth between January and April of 2022. The analysis of data uses Chi Square. Research Results: This study resulted in the distribution of the frequency of the influence of the Covid-19 pandemic anxiety on the smoothness of breastfeeding as many as 24 people (40.7%) while on smooth breastfeeding for postpartum mothers as many as 33 people (55.9%), who experienced Covid19 anxiety levels in postpartum mothers. the medium category was 19 people (32.2%), the level of anxiety of the Covid-19 pandemic in postpartum mothers was low as many as 16 people (10.2%) while breastfeeding was not smooth in postpartum mothers as many as 26 people (44, 1%) P value: 0.000 which is smaller than (0.05). Conclusion and recommendation: With increasing levels of anxiety during the COVID-19 pandemic, the ability of postpartum mothers to breastfeed will be hindered. From this finding, the researcher makes a recommendation or input to postpartum women, namely to regulate their emotions so that they do not have worry over anything, particularly the covid-19 epidemic. In order to make the breast milk that will be given to the baby smooth.
